About

Genius Annotation

Fuse TV brought rapper Hoodie Allen together with singer/songwriter Kina Grannis to write this moody, piano-driven track within 24 hours. It had its debut in front of a live audience while the finished product lends both artists vocals to the catchy, radio-ready chorus. Over Something Silent’s production, DJ Fresh Direct‘s sampled rhythms, and driven by Kina’s acoustic-guitar chords, Hoodie charts his growth from underdog to indie phenom with Make It Home.
